Utilizing Biometrics to Fortify App Security

With the increasing complexity of cyber threats, mobile app security has become a paramount concern. Traditional authentication methods like passwords and PINs are vulnerable to hacking and phishing attacks. Biometric authentication offers a reliable alternative by leveraging unique biological traits for user identification. Facial recognition, among other biometric modalities, provide a more powerful layer of security, making it challenging for unauthorized users to gain access to sensitive data.

Integrating biometric authentication in apps can significantly reduce the risk of security breaches. It enhances user privacy by eliminating the need to remember complex passwords and reduces the likelihood of account takeover. Furthermore , biometrics provide a seamless and user-friendly experience, making it attractive for users.
